Prep Time:20 mins
Cook Time:40 mins
Total Time:60 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 6 pieces boneless, skinless chicken thighs
  • 3 medium-sized russet potatoes
  • 4 tablespoons ol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ons lime juice
  • 2 teaspoons ch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 1 teaspoon ground cumin
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• 1.5 teaspoons kosher salt
  • 0.5 teaspoon black pepper
  • 2 tablespoons fresh cilantro (optional, for garnish)

Directions

Step 1

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a large baking sheet with parchment paper or foil for easy cleanup.

Step 2

Peel and dice the russet potatoes into 1-inch cubes. Place the potatoes in a large mixing bowl.

Step 3

In a separate small bowl, whisk together olive oil, lime juice, chili powder, smoked paprika, ground cumin, garlic powder, onion powder, dried oregano, kosher salt, and black pepper.

Step 4

Pour half of the spice mixture over the diced potatoes. Toss well to coat evenly and set aside.

Step 5

Place the chicken thighs in another bowl. Pour the remaining spice mixture over the chicken and massage the marinade into the meat.

Step 6

Spread the seasoned potatoes evenly on the prepared baking sheet. Arrange the chicken thighs on top of the potatoes, ensuring they are in a single layer for even cooking.

Step 7

Bake in the preheated oven for 35-40 minutes, or until the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) and the potatoes are golden and tender.

Step 8

Remove the baking sheet from the oven and let the dish cool slightly before garnishing with freshly chopped cilantro, if desired.

Step 9

Serve warm, or allow the dish to cool completely before storing in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 4 days. Reheat when ready to serve.
